Infinix Mobility launches elegantly designed Smart TV S1 into the Nigerian market

Infinix, Africa’s premium online-driven smartphone brand, designed for the young and stylish generation has unveiled its new Smart TV product - S1 into the Nigerian electronics Market.

The Infinix smart TV comes in two sizes; 43 Inches and 55 Inches and is the first Smart TV that sports an ultra-high level of interaction with smartphones. Designed for young consumers, the TV adopts an elegant design as well as intelligent functions that will give the market a surprise.

The Infinix TV provides young consumers with an “Elegant” and “Intelligent” viewing experience.

Speaking of the S1’s elegant design, “Craftsmanship” is a key word. The frame-less TV design allows for an immersive wide view. The Infinix smart TV 55S1 is equipped with a 4K (Ultra HD) screen. Also, to ensure the picture quality, HDR function shows delicate details and lifelike colors with a larger range of contrast. Together with the 2*10W full range speakers, the S1 interacts seamlessly with smartphones, allowing its users to experience a new and amazing view-time.

ADVERTISEMENT

In addition to this, the Infinix Life APP on your smartphone will deliver a fully featured immersive experience with your Infinix smart TV. The Hotspot Screen mirroring lets you to mirror your mobile device to the TV screen using your mobile hotspot without consuming mobile data. Finding the TV remote controller after a long and stressful day at work will no longer be an issue because with the E-remote function, you can now use your smartphone via Infinix Life APP for full TV control. The TV also comes with Bluetooth 4.0 which is easy to connect with the speakers, earphones and game controllers, providing a super fast entertainment experiences.

Other than the powerful and intelligent functions, the wide voltage range design will operate flawlessly without malfunctioning or damaging the TV when voltage inputs are unstable.

Specifications of the Infinix S1

43S1 (43 inch) 55S1(55 inch)
Resolution 1920*1080 3840*2160
Memory 1+8GB 1.5+8GB
Brightness 250nits typ 300 nits typ
Design Metallic design, full screen Metallic design, full screen
OS Android Android
Cast Hotspot mirroring Hotspot mirroring
Speaker 2*10W 2*10W
Product Warranty 24M 24M

Launched in 2013 and targeting the young generations, Infinix Mobile is a premium online-driven smartphone brand. With “THE FUTURE IS NOW” as the brand essence, Infinix aims to allow consumers to stand out in the crowd and to show the world who they really are. Infinix is committed to providing the most cutting-edge technologies, bold and stylish designs, keeping consumers on trend and up-to-date. Infinix's portfolio spans five product lines – ZERO, NOTE, HOT, S, and SMART; empowering users to own innovative technologies and experience intelligent lifestyles! Infinix has a presence in more than 40 countries around the world, covering Africa, Latin America, the Middle East, Southeast Asia and South Asia.
